Whether your face is square, oval, round, heart-shaped or oblong, there’s a style out there to bring out your features.
Reece Witherspoon’s heart-shaped style
Wear a deep side part like Reece Witherspoon to give the appearance of wider cheekbones.
The deep side part for heart-shaped faces
Rocking a deep side part with big curls will help draw attention out and away from a pointier chin.
Wispy bangs for heart-shaped faces
Any bangs, even if they are a more blunt cut, should have a wispy effect.
Chloë Grace Moretz’s heart-shaped style
Face-framing layers will help give your face a rounder appearance.
Loose curls for heart-shaped faces
Use larger curling iron wands to create the big, loose curls that flatter heart face shapes.
Jennifer Lawrence’s round face style
Style your hair with a middle part, and let some longer bangs hang to help elongate your face.
Short cut style tips for round faces
With shorter cuts that aren’t a pixie, have the cut sit below your cheekbones to avoid extra emphasis near your cheeks.
Angled layers for round faces
When your hair is pulled back or if you’re a round face with a short bob, angle layers down to lengthen your face.
Volume for round faces
Added volume should be always be on top of your head.
Mindy Kaling’s round-face style
Long hair will help elongate your face. Ombre is a bonus because it adds extra emphasis down instead of out.
Ginnifer Godwin’s round-face pixie
Pull off a pixie by keeping the volume at the top and shorter and thinner on the sides.
Olivia Wilde’s square-face style
Try wearing a middle part — letting your hair hang on each side will help disguise cheeks and soften harsh face angles.
Casual, long waves for square faces
Longer hair with casual waves is a square face shape’s dream.
Jessica Biel’s square-face style
Bangs on square face-shaped ladies should curl under to help create a rounder appearance.
Jennifer Hudson’s side-part for square faces
Side parts or parts slightly off center will help turn a square face into a rounder shape.
Keria Knightley’s lob for square faces
If you want to chop your hair into a bob, ask for long, angled layers that elongate your face shape.
